ORACLE DATABASE DEVELOPER
Leonteq is looking for a Senior Oracle Database Developer in Lisbon to develop and optimize data warehouses and reporting solutions in the financial sector. The position requires at least five years of experience in Oracle SQL/PL/SQL, data modeling, and performance tuning.

What You'll Do
- Contribute to the design and development of a data warehouse based on Oracle Database 19c Enterprise Edition
- Develop scalable, efficient, and maintainable PL/SQL code for data movement, transformation, and reporting
- Implement complex reporting solutions in areas such as risk, finance, and regulatory reporting
- Collaborate with business users to understand requirements, workflows, and data needs
- Refactor and enhance legacy systems to improve reliability, performance, and maintainability
- Write clean, reliable code in accordance with Leonteq’s best practices and development standards
- Optimize SQL and PL/SQL code by leveraging advanced Oracle features such as parallel queries, compression, and advanced analytics using techniques such as AWM
- Optimize database and query performance using tools such as AWM and Real-Time SQL Monitoring
- Support data modeling activities using techniques such as Kimball, Data Vault, or 3NF
- Work in an agile, collaborative environment, contributing to design reviews and monitoring.
What You'll Need
- 5+ years of experience in Oracle SQL and PL/SQL development
- Strong understanding of data modeling for data warehouses, including dimensional modeling, best practices in data warehousing, and normalization techniques
- In-depth knowledge of advanced SQL concepts, including analytical functions, hierarchical queries, complex joins, partitioning, and parallel execution
- Hands-on experience in performance tuning and troubleshooting using Oracle diagnostic tools and profiling (e.g., ASH, AWR)
